15 provinces have released the data on the permanent resident population of last year.
Recently, several provinces have released their population data for last year. Currently, 15 provinces have announced their population data for last year. Among them, the recent release of the 2025 National Economic and Social Development Statistics Bulletin for Fujian Province showed a year-end resident population of 41.9 million. According to the data, the year-end resident population in Fujian was 41.93 million in 2024, indicating a decrease of 30,000 residents last year. By the end of 2025, Jiangsu had a resident population of 85.18 million, a decrease of 80,000 from the previous year; Anhui had a resident population of 60.82 million, a decrease of 410,000 from the previous year; Hubei had a resident population of 58.11 million, a decrease of 230,000 from the previous year; Sichuan had a resident population of 83.18 million, a decrease of 460,000 from the year-end; Shandong had a resident population of 100.43 million, a decrease of 371,700 from the previous year; Qinghai had a resident population of 5.92 million, a decrease of 10,000 from the previous year; Guangxi had a resident population of 49.89 million, a decrease of 240,000 from the previous year; Guizhou had a resident population of 38.57 million, a decrease of 30,000 from the previous year; Gansu had a resident population of 24.43 million, a decrease of 150,000 from the previous year.
